Note for Tindervale plugin partners: the Corewright host now hot-reloads configuration every 30 seconds. Plugins must re-read injected config values rather than caching them at startup, and must tolerate partial reloads without crashing. Validate against the v4 sandbox before your next release. Report reload-related regressions, with logs attached, to the integrations desk here.

alerts address for kajog-tadup: druox@plorvanet.internal

# Queue constants for the Veriquill proctoring pipeline.
# Each exam session enters the intake queue, gets assigned a
# reviewer slot, and times out if no proctor claims it. Don't
# change these without checking with the capacity planning sheet,
# since they directly affect how many sessions we can hold open.
# The current tuning values are defined below.

tuning constants:
QUOTAS = {
    "druwyn": 5,
    "holix": 5,
    "zorath": 5,
    "holwyn": 10,
}

**Timeline — 14:22**: The Grathon garage occupancy feed began reporting negative stall counts after the nightly schema migration renamed the `occupied` column. Downstream, the Veylane parking app showed garages as fully open, and gate controllers stopped throttling entry. On-call disabled the feed at 14:31 and restored the prior snapshot at 14:47. Root cause: the migration shipped without the corresponding reader update, which was still pending review. The reader hotfix was cut from the build referenced below.

session token of kageg-tahop = htk14_af3c1ccccb7dcf

Root cause: our 3.2 release changed the default font-metric stub used during snapshot rendering, so every baseline image shifted by two pixels. Plugin authors: this was not a fault in your components. We have restored the old stub behind a compatibility flag and regenerated the canonical baselines. If your pipeline pinned our renderer, rebaseline against the restored stub. The corrected renderer build is identified by the token below.

session token of kawip-yajeg = htk6_209e95